Budget bills omit New York City speed cameras

Dana Rubinstein

Governor Andrew Cuomo and the state legislature appear to have denied a request from Mayor Bill de Blasio for 160 new speed cameras, an integral part of his Vision Zero plan to dramatically reduce traffic deaths in New York City.

Legislative leaders have yet to publicly announce a budget agreement, but budget bills printed late Friday night and early Saturday morning do not include the requested cameras.
